Seasonal allergies to spike as warmer weather approaches

CHICOPEE, Mass. (WWLP) – The spring season is here! And with warmer weather and sunshine soon to come, that also means seasonal allergies for many people.

According to the Asthma and Allergy Foundation of America, pollen is one of the most common triggers of seasonal allergies. There are three main types of pollen allergy: tree pollen, grass pollen, and weed pollen. Tree pollen is the first pollen to appear each year in the US between February and May.
